We provide IT Staff Augmentation Services!

 it Consultant Resume

3.00/5 (Submit Your Rating)

CA

SUMMARY:

  • 8+ years of experience in IT industry worked with all phases of Analysis, Design, development, testing and documentation of Web Based Applications.
  • 3 years of experience in Content Management System with Adobe AEM 5.6, AEM 6.0, AEM 6.1.
  • Designed and developed websites/pages in Adobe CQ/AEM by implementing the responsive design.
  • Worked on creating workflows and user administration in AEM.
  • Worked on dispatcher configuration for caching and load balance.
  • Good understanding on Blueprints, Live Copies with CQ MSM
  • Created custom sling bundles as part of new functionalities provided to CQ sites
  • Extensively used Adobe CRX, CRXDE, WCM, Components, Workflows, Widgets, Package Manager and DAM.
  • Strong experience in Adobe related technologies like Sling, OSGI, Apache Felix, Jackrabbit, JCR and CRX.
  • Used Coral / Granite UI to implement touch based dialogs. And ExtJs for classic UI dialogs
  • Expert in developing custom CQ components and modify the out of the box components.
  • Strong experience implementing the OSGI services.
  • Good understanding in authoring and publishing Adobe CQ applications.
  • Expert in User Management, Tag Management.
  • Good experiencing in customization of Workflows and Adobe UI.
  • Experience in Configuring Replication Agents, Reverse Replication Agents and Dispatcher Flush.
  • Experience in creating users and groups and assigning permissions under user management.
  • Experience in configuring custom log files for some services from web console.
  • Rich experience in client side design and validations using HTML/HTML5, XML, Ajax, JQuery, Angular.js, CSS/CSS3 and Javascript.
  • Expertise in Object Oriented Analysis, Design/Development Methodologies, Java and J2EE Core Design Patterns (MVC, Singleton, Builder, Factory, DAO)
  • Expertise in developing Web applications using various open source frameworks like Spring, Hibernate.
  • Experience in Spring Framework, Spring Dependency Injection, Spring MVC, Spring AOP and Spring JDBC & Hibernate Template, Spring Transaction Management and integration
  • Experience in configuring and coding with ORM Frameworks like Hibernate.
  • Expertise in Web Application Development using Servlets, JSP, JDBC, JSTL and XML.
  • Experience in development of Web Services using SOAP and Rest.
  • Experience in using ANT and Maven for build automation.
  • Hands - on experience with databases including Oracle, MySql involving stored procedures, triggers, functions, indexes, and packages.
  • Worked on Jenkins, Hudson for continuous integration.
  • Good knowledge on No SQL database mongoDB.

TECHNICAL SKILLS:

Languages: JAVA, SQL, PL/SQL

Operating Systems: Windows, Unix/Linux

Web Tech: J2EE, Servlets, JSP, Web Services.

Frameworks: Spring, Hibernate

Client side Scripting: Java Script, JQUERY, Angular.js, CSS, AJAX, HTML.

App & Web Servers: WebLogic, JBoss, Tomcat

Source Control: ClearCase, SVN, GIT

Database: Oracle, MySQL, MongoDB

IDE: Eclipse, IntelliJ, Netbeans

Build Tools: ANT/Maven

WCM Tools: Adobe CQ 5 5.6/6.0/6.1, DAM, JCR API, CRX, Dispatchers, Package Manager.

PROFESSIONAL EXPERIENCE:

Confidential,CA

IT Consultant

Responsibilities:

  • Installed and Configured CQ5 Authoring & Publishing Instance.
  • Developed and deployed java code via OSGI bundle.
  • Developed custom workflow to set the all-users author inherited group permission to false when a new portal is created under home site. Making the portal accessible to only the authors of that site.
  • Worked on SAML single sign-on for authentication.
  • Used out of the box components and modified to add additional fields to the dialog.
  • Worked on Coral/Granite UI for creating dialogs for content editing.
  • Configured Replication Agents, Reverse Replication Agent and Dispatcher Flush.
  • Integrated REST web service(JSON) with Adobe AEM to get specific information from the external application.
  • Swagger console was used to test the external web application response.
  • Worked on DAM for creating and storing assets like images, audio clips and video clips.
  • Worked on creating users and assigning them to groups and granting permissions.
  • Worked on dispatcher configuration for caching.
  • Worked on Creating tags and assigned to pages under tag management.
  • Configured cutom log files for some services using web console.
  • Worked on HTML template language Sightly.
  • Developed Adobe CQ templates and reusable components.
  • Better understanding of Classic/Touch Modes and created few dialogs and design dialogs.
  • Used jQuery core library functions for the logical implementation part at client side for all the application.
  • Developed and designed the front end using HTML, Javascript and CSS.
  • Written test cases using JUNIT.
  • Involved in migration of AEM from 5.6 to 6.1.
  • Testing support during UAT and production.
  • Involved in building, deploying the code and moving code to different environments.

Environment: Java, J2EE, AEM 6.1, CQ5 DAM, CQ Tagging, Workflow, Apache Sling, Apache Felix, Sightly (HTL), CRXDE Lite, JCR, WCM, Dispatcher, HTML, JavaScript, jQuery, Tomcat 7, Apache Maven, GIT, Jenkins, Junit, JIRA, REST Web Services.

Confidential, Mountain View, CA

Computers System Analyst

Responsibilities:
  • Worked on creating Components, Pages, Templates, design dialogs, widgets.
  • Responsible for design, development and unit and integration testing of Day CQ components, templates and the corresponding web services.
  • Wrote test cases for testing of CQ components and templates in both authoring and publishing environments.
  • Worked on creating and customizing workflows.
  • Developed and deployed java code via OSGI bundle.
  • Configured Dispatcher Flush for invalidating cached pages.
  • Configured Replication Agents and Reverse Replication Agents to publish content.
  • Worked on Creating users/groups, assign users to groups and setting permissions.
  • Design and development of web pages using CQ5, JavaScript, HTML, CSS, Ajax and jQuery.
  • Worked on Java Sever Pages (JSP) for business logic.
  • Worked on Sling servlets to handle POST and GET requests.
  • Developed Adobe CQ5 templates and reusable components.
  • Worked on ExtJs for creating dialogs for authors to edit content dynamically.
  • Worked on creating tags and assigning it to pages.

Environment: Adobe CQ5/AEM 5.6, J2EE, JSP, Servlets, Java Script, Workflows, HTML, CSS, Ajax, jQuery, Apache Sling, Dispatcher, Ant, ClearCase, Hudson, CRXDE, CRX, WCM.

ConfidentialMA

Oracle Consultant

Responsibilities:
  • Worked on implementing CQ5 from procurement of product to training, project planning, requirement gathering, analysis, estimates and implementation.
  • Worked on implementing Responsive design on CQ5 platform using frameworks like Twitter Bootstrap and Foundation.
  • Developed complex components with dialog on CQ5 using jQuery, Zepto, HTML and CSS.
  • Developed functionality specific OSGi bundles on CQ5.
  • Doing impact analysis and creating High Level Design Document and Low Level Design Document as per the Functional Specifications Document.
  • Developing components and templates in Adobe CQ5.
  • Build responsive application using AngularJS, NodeJs. Application compatible with mobile devices and different web platforms and browser. Consumed different plugins and angular modules and providers
  • Prepare unit test cases and integration test cases.
  • Extensively worked on front end, business and persistence tier using the HTML, CSS, JavaScript, jQuery, and Hibernate frameworks.
  • Used Eclipse Integrated Development Environment (IDE) in entire project development.
  • Using Interwoven Teamsite CMS for deploying contents on QA, STG and PROD environment.
  • Performed unit testing, system testing and integration testing.
  • Coding for the service requirements as per the scheduled releases.
  • Code review, unit testing and local Integration testing.
  • Testing support during UAT and production.
  • Integrating of application modules, components and deploying in the target platform.
  • Ownership of build and release activities.
  • Suggesting innovations and doing subsequent analysis for the same.
  • Mentoring new team members.

Environment: Database: Oracle 11g, Hibernate 2.0, Day CQ5.6.1, CQ5.6, CQ5.5 (WCM), Apache Sling, CRXDE, CRX, WCM, Front End technologies: JSP, JavaScript, CSS, HTML, jQuery, Servers: JBoss 4.0.2, Tomcat 2.2

Confidential

Associate Consultant

Responsibilities:
  • Involved in design and development of server side layer using XML, JSP, JDBC, JNDI and DAO patterns using Eclipse IDE.
  • Designed and developed JSP Pages using Spring Frame work and Tag libraries.
  • Involved in implementation of Spring MVC framework and developed DAO and Service layers. Configured the controllers, and different beans such as Handler Mapping, View Resolver etc.
  • Created Hibernate configuration files, Spring Application context file.
  • Designed and developed various modules of the application with frameworks like Spring MVC, Web Flow, architecture and Spring Bean Factory using IOC, AOP concepts.
  • Followed Agile software development with Scrum methodology.
  • Used Log4j for logging and debugging.
  • Using Spring-AOP module implemented features like logging, user session validation.
  • Used Jenkins to build and maintain the code for testing the application using a test interface locally.
  • Worked on JMS Queue for processing the messages.
  • Version control of the code and configuration files are maintained by GIT and involved in Unit Testing
  • Used Hibernate3 with annotation to handle all database operations.
  • Worked on generating the SOAP Web Services classes by using Service oriented architecture (SOA).
  • Worked in deadline driven environment with immediate feature release cycles.

Environment: Java, spring, Hibernate, SOAP, JBoss, Log4j, JUnit, Eclipse, Subversion, Jenkins, MySQL.

We'd love your feedback!